It was drawn by Gilbert Sommerlad (1904-1976), a rehearsal pianist and orchestral violinist at the Brighton Theatre Royal from 1932 until 1936, and at the Oxford New Theatre from 1936 for over forty years.  Sommerlad sketched the stars on stage when he wasn't needed in the orchestra pit, compiling the sketches in a series of albums.\r\n\r\nKenneth Williams, actor, comedian, and raconteur, made his first stage appearance in 1948 after working in the Combined Services Entertainment Unit during the war.  In the 1950s and 1960s he combined  television, stage, and radio work, and became one of the most popular performers in radio's <i>Round The Horne</i>, and in the 22 <i>Carry On</i> films in which he appeared.","physicalDescription":"Pencil, pen and ink and wash caricature on paper of Kenneth Williams as Bernard in <i>The Platinum Cat</i> at the New Theatre Oxford.
